  • Jim Dyer, Franchise Owner

    Jim Dyer

    Franchise Owner

    Jim Dyer, owner of 9 Sylvan Learning Centers, spent 30 years in California Public Education. He taught high school for 8 years and was a Junior High Principal for 24 years. Jim has also taught Junior College classes in Speech and worked with Chapman University in the teacher credentialing department for the Inland Empire. In 2001 Jim began working extensively with the Sylvan Learning Centers. The best part of Sylvan for Jim is the same as it was working in Public Education....working with students and parents! Jim earned both his Bachelor of Arts and his Masters Degrees from Whittier College, Whittier, California.
  • Carli Ganet, Executive Director - Franchise Owner

    Carli Ganet

    Executive Director - Franchise Owner

    Carli Ganet is the Executive Director and Co-Owner of the 11 Sylvan Learning Centers owned by Jim and Fran Dyer. Carli received her Bachelors of Arts and Teaching Credential at the University of Denver in Denver, Colorado. Carli began her career with Sylvan as a student in the Rancho Cucamonga Sylvan Learning Center. She has been a Director of Education, Center Director and currently oversees the educational programs of Sylvan students as well as working with Directors and Parents. She loves working with Sylvan families!
